New Delhi, Sep 14: Families of Israeli hostages still held by Hamas have accused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u of being the "one obstacle" to their release and to reaching a ceasefire agreement. In a statement posted on social media, the Hostages and Missing Families Forum said Israel's strike in Qatar last week showed that "every time a deal approaches, Netanyahu sabotages it." According to the BBC, Israel targeted senior Hamas leaders in the Qatari capital Doha on Tuesday, killing five members of the group and a Qatari security officer. Hamas said its officials had been meeting there to discuss a US-backed ceasefire proposal. Netanyahu defended the attack, saying it removed "the main obstacle" to freeing hostages and ending the war, and accused Hamas of blocking all ceasefire attempts. But hostage families dismissed his comments as "the latest excuse," adding: "The time has come to end the excuses designed to buy time so he can cling to power." The families' criticism comes as US Secretary of State Marco Rubio visits Israel amid widespread condemnation of the Doha strike. Qatar, a key American ally that hosts a major US air base, denounced the operation as a "flagrant violation of international law." Meanwhile, Israeli forces have intensified air strikes on Gaza City, warning residents to evacuate ahead of an expected ground offensive.

Tel Avis [Israel], November 18 (ANI): An Israeli strike in the Lebanese capital Beirut killed Hezbollah's media relations chief Mohammed Afif on Sunday, Times of Israel reported. According to the Times of Israel, Hezbollah has confirmed the death of Mohammad Afif. Afif was killed in an IDF strike on the headquarters of the Syrian Ba'ath Party in central Beirut, Times of Israel reported. Israel is yet to confirm the killing of the Hezbollah spokesman, as per the Times of Israel. United Nations, November 27 (IANS): The United Nations welcomes the announcement of a ceasefire between Israel and Lebanon, a senior UN official said in a statement. The agreement marks the starting point of a critical process, anchored in the full implementation of resolution 1701 (2006), to restore the safety and security that civilians on both sides of the Blue Line deserve, said Jeanine Hennis-Plasschaert, the UN special coordinator for Lebanon, on Tuesday, Xinhua news agency reported. Fiuggi, November 27 (IANS): Foreign ministers from the Group of Seven (G7) countries called on Israel to comply with its obligations under international law at a meeting. The ministers said in a statement that they support a ceasefire between Israel and Hezbollah and the full implementation of United Nations Security Council Resolution 1701, Xinhua news agency reported. The ministers expressed their concern about the humanitarian situation in Gaza. They called on the Israeli government to ease obstacles on humanitarian aid to civilians in areas rocked by conflicts. AMRITSAR, India (AP) -- A U.S. military plane carrying 104 deported Indian migrants arrived in a northern Indian city on Wednesday, the first such flight to the country as part of a crackdown ordered by the Trump administration, airport officials said. The Indians who returned home had illegally entered the United States over the years and came from various Indian states. The move came ahead of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i's visit to Washington, which is expected next week. New Delhi, Jun 29: Ukraine has confirmed the loss of an F-16 fighter jet and its pilot during efforts to repel a large-scale Russian air assault, amid continued heavy fighting in the fourth year of war reports Al Jazeera and International media. The country's air force said the aircraft was engaged in defending against a barrage of missiles and drones when it was damaged and lost altitude. Ukrainian air defences reportedly shot down seven targets before the fighter crashed overnight. The pilot, identified as a first-class officer, was killed in the incident.
